Output ef4d848a9817b0219505cec2080c3ad712aaf59e8e7c6a5cfe7a369781144e2e:3

value
113067
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ffe86aa49fc1414b47c7149b45b2e5f82a556ee2 OP_EQUAL
address
3R28f3h4ZTwLER9wyzCB2T9VfSffvtvpRy
transaction
ef4d848a9817b0219505cec2080c3ad712aaf59e8e7c6a5cfe7a369781144e2e
confirmations
178714
spent
true